Outcomes of Endoscopic Ultrasound-Guided Gallbladder Drainage Using Lumen-Apposing Metal Stent Performed by Early Career Advanced Endoscopists: A Multicenter Study

Endoscopic ultrasound-guided gallbladder drainage (EUS-GBD) has gained popularity for acute cholecystitis (AC) management in patients deemed unfit for surgery. Recent studies have found > 95% technical success and > 90% clinical success when performed by experienced advanced endoscopists. Recently, the U.S. Food and Drug Administration (FDA) approved the use of lumen-apposing metal stent (LAMS) for EUS-GBD. The aim of this study is to evaluate the safety and efficacy of EUS-GBD performed by early-career advanced endoscopists in North America.
MethodsThis was a retrospective multicenter study of patients who underwent EUS-GBD performed by 8 early-career advanced endoscopists (defined as within 3 years of graduation from advanced endoscopy fellowship (AEF)) between January 2021 and March 2024. Primary outcomes included technical success (ability to place LAMS into the gallbladder) and clinical success (resolution of symptoms and laboratory abnormalities). Secondary outcomes included adverse events (AEs) and 30-day readmission rates.
ResultsA total of 57 patients (mean age 70.7 years, 59.6% male) were included. The most common site of EUS-GBD was the duodenum (57.9%) and LAMS size 10 × 10 mm (71.9%). The technical success rate was 98.2%, and the clinical success rate was 98.2%. AEs occurred in 3.5% (n = 2), including gallbladder perforation and recurrent AC following stent migration. The 30-day readmission rate was 5.3% (n = 3). There was no procedure-related mortality.
ConclusionsOur study demonstrates that EUS-GBD is safe and effective when performed by early-career advanced endoscopists. These outcomes are similar to previous data when performed by experienced advanced endoscopists.
